The Milk Development Council (Amendment) Order 2004

Section 1Title, commencement and interpretation

(1) This Order may be cited as the Milk Development Council (Amendment) Order 2004 and shall come into force on 1st April 2004.

(2) In this Order “the principal Order ” means the Milk Development Council Order 1995 .

Section 2Amendment of the principal Order

The principal Order shall be amended in accordance with the following provisions of this Order.

Section 3Amendment of the principal Order

In article 2 (interpretation), in paragraph (1) after the definition of “producer”, there shall be inserted the following definition—

“production year” means a period of 12 months starting on 1st April and ending on 31st March;

Section 4Amendment of the principal Order

For article 8 (returns and information) there shall be substituted the following article—

Returns and information

(8)

(1) Subject to paragraph (4), the Council may require any registered producer to furnish such returns and information relating to activities carried out as part of his business and comprised in the industry as appear to the Council to be required for the exercise of any of their functions.

(2) Paragraph (3) applies where the Council, pursuant to paragraph (1), requires any Case B producer to make a return to the Council for any production year within one month after the end of that production year.

(3) Where a Case B producer fails to make a return within the period mentioned in paragraph (2), the following procedure shall apply—

(a) the Council shall make an estimate of the producer’s milk production in the relevant production year by reference to information which is available to the Council concerning the extent of that production;

(b) where such information is not available to the Council, they shall make an estimate of the extent of the producer’s milk production by reference to the quota registered in his name on 31st March in the production year pursuant to the Dairy Produce Quotas Regulations 2002 , the Dairy Produce Quotas (Wales) Regulations 2002 or the Dairy Produce Quotas (Scotland) Regulations 2002 , and any other relevant information which is available to the Council;

(c) where an estimate is made under sub-paragraph (b), the amount of the estimate may be increased by up to 10% where it appears to the Council that the total milk production in the United Kingdom in the production year may exceed the total quota registered in that year pursuant to the Regulations referred to in sub-paragraph (b) above and the Dairy Produce Quotas Regulations (Northern Ireland) 2002 ;

(d) the Council shall then give the producer notice in writing—

(i) that they have made such an estimate and the amount of it; and

(ii) that the amount of the estimate, increased (in accordance with sub-paragraph (c)) by up to 10% where an estimate is made under sub-paragraph (b), may, if the producer fails to make a return within 28 days of the date of the notice, be treated as his return for the production year;

(e) the producer may within 28 days of the date of the notice make a return and the Council will accept this as his return;

(f) if the producer fails to make such a return within 28 days of the date of the notice, then the amount of the estimate, or the amount of the estimate increased (in accordance with sub-paragraph (c)) by up to 10% where an estimate is made under sub-paragraph (b), may, if the Council so decides, be treated as his return.

(4) The Council shall not exercise the powers conferred upon them under this article generally as regards the industry or any section thereof unless the Ministers have consented to such exercise and have approved the form in which the returns or other information will be required to be furnished.

(5) In this article, a “Case B producer” means a producer liable to pay a charge to the Council in accordance with article 9(2)(b).

Section 5Saving

Notwithstanding the provisions of this Order, the provisions of the principal Order in force prior to the coming into force of this Order shall continue to apply in relation to any charge payable by producers in respect of any period ending on or before 31st March 2004.
